The BCA course, or Bachelor of Computer Applications, is a three-year undergraduate program that gives students a foundational and advanced understanding of computer applications and information technology. Throughout the program, students study a wide range of subjects, like programming languages, operating systems, data structures, database management systems, web development, and software engineering.
Let’s explore the BCA course and its eligibility and take a quick look at the promising career opportunities that await BCA graduates.
BCA stands for Bachelor of Computer Applications. It is an undergraduate academic degree in the field of computer science. Usually lasting three years, the course covers a wide range of computer science and application-related subjects, including databases, computer networks, programming, data structures, algorithms, and software development.
The curriculum is made to give students a solid foundation in computer science and to get them ready for jobs in programming, software development, and other related disciplines. Some universities also offer specialization in areas like Artificial Intelligence, Machine Learning, Cloud Computing, and Cyber security. BCA is a popular choice for students who are interested in computer science and want to pursue a career in the technology industry.
Table of Content
Today, BCA is one of the most popular undergraduate degree programs in India and many other countries. It is a widely recognized and respected degree that is valued by employers in the technology industry.
Particulars | Details |
---|---|
Course Level | UG (Undergraduate) |
Course Duration | 3 Years |
Examination Type | Semester System |
Eligibility | 10+2 with a minimum of 50% from a recognized board |
BCA Admission Process | Either by Entrance Exams or by Merit |
Entrance Exams | CUET, SET, IPU CET, MET, DSAT, CUCET |
Top Colleges | Banasthali Vidyapith, Christ University, Chandigarh University, Guru Gobind Singh Indraprastha University |
Average Course Fee | INR 80,000 – 3 Lakh |
Average Starting Salary | Rs 3-8 LPA |
BCA Recruiting Organisations | HCL, HP, Infosys, Accenture, TCS, Capgemini, Cognizant, Flipkart, Amazon, NIIT, and others |
BCA Jobs | Technical Analysts, System Administrators, Software Developers, Programmers, Tech support, and others |
The scope of BCA is very wide and there are many different job profiles that BCA graduates can pursue. Some of the most popular job profiles for BCA graduates include:
After earning a BCA, one can pick from a variety of master’s degree programs for individuals looking to get a specialized postgraduate degree. This includes:
BCA degree graduates have several opportunities to land well-paying jobs in the IT industry. Both large corporations and start-ups provide a variety of opportunities to them.
Software development companies, IT companies, banks, healthcare organizations, educational institutions, government agencies, and numerous other industries actively hire BCA graduates. An applicant has a wide range of options if they wish to pursue postgraduate coursework, such as the MBA, MCA, MS, and many more.
The requirements for a Bachelor of Computer Applications [BCA] study can vary depending on the school or college offering the degree. However, majority of BCA courses often include the following prerequisites:
Here in this section, you will get a complete list of BCA semester wise syllabus. Explore it and find out what are the subjects you have to study during the BCA cource.
Explore the below list to get an idea of which are the top BCA colleges in India and what are their fees and placement salary after completing Bachelor of Computer Applications.
Christ University, Bangalore
St Xavier’s College, Mumbai
Symbiosis Institute of Computer Studies and Research(SICSR), Pune
Loyola College, Chennai
Amity University, Noida
Madras Christian College(MCC), Chennai
Guru Gobind Singh Indraprastha University
Presidency College, Bengaluru
Some of the Top Recruiters for BCA graduates in India are:
To pursue BCA or Bachelor of Computer Applications, then there is number of examination held. Through these examination you can easily get an addimision in India’s top government colleges as well as private colleges.
BCA Entrance Exam
Common University Entrance Test(CUET)
May 15 to 31, 2024
Indraprastha University Common Entrance Test(IPU CET)
Symbiosis Entrance Test(SET)
Manipal Entrance Test(MET)
October, 2023 onwards
February – March 2024
May 15 – 31, 2024
Dayanand Sagar Admission Test(DSAT)
Want to study BCA from top government colleges in India, then here in this section we have list all the best and reputative government colleges that offers BCA program.
If you are looking for private colleges for BCA course, then here in this section we have listed all the top private colleges in India that offers BCA cource.
BCA is more application oriented whereas BSc Computer Science focuses more on concepts . In the BCA course, you’ll gain an understanding of modern programming languages and their applications along with a fundamental awareness of today’s technology. However, the BCA course won’t provide you a comprehensive conceptual knowledge.
The BSc in Computer Science is more concept-focused. In this course, there won’t be much emphasis on current applications and technology. Since BCA is application-oriented, candidates with backgrounds in the arts, sciences, or commerce are eligible to apply. However, you must have a mathematics based intermediate qualification to apply for a BSc Computer Science program.
Since BCA gives students the essential computer science and application skills they need to succeed in the current IT job market, it is a popular choice for students who want to work in the field of information technology (IT) and computer-related sectors. It provides a range of employment options in fields like technology, healthcare, finance, and railways, as well as special positions in public sector banks and Indian Railways. While BCA graduates have promising job prospects, they must actively improve their skills to become job-ready.
The number of subjects in BCA will vary depending on the college or university you attend. However, most BCA programs typically offer between 40 and 50 subjects over the course of the degree i.e 6-8 subjects every semester.
The difficulty of BCA will vary depending on your individual skills and experience, as well as how the teacher teaches the course. However, in general, BCA is considered a challenging degree due to the demanding subjects that require a strong understanding of mathematics and computer science. Nevertheless, if you are willing to put in the hard work, BCA can be a rewarding and fulfilling degree that can get you a job in Top MNC’s such as Microsoft, Amazon, Apple etc.